
Frameworks, core principles and top case studies for SaaS pricing, learnt and refined over 28+ years of SaaS-monetization experience.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
Join companies like Zoom, DocuSign, and Twilio using our systematic pricing approach to increase revenue by 12-40% year-over-year.
Pricing developer tools isn't like pricing typical SaaS products. Your buyers write code for a living, evaluate tools hands-on before any sales conversation, and share opinions across Twitter, Reddit, and internal Slack channels. Get your code quality tech pricing wrong, and you'll watch developers abandon your tool mid-evaluation—then tell their entire network why.
Quick answer: Price developer tools by tiering usage-based metrics (repos, lines of code, scan frequency) combined with capability gating (advanced rules, integrations, enterprise security) while keeping core code quality features accessible to build trust with technical buyers who evaluate before purchasing.
Technical buyers behave fundamentally differently than traditional B2B purchasers. They expect to install, configure, and evaluate your tool—often for weeks—before engaging with sales or entering payment information. This bottom-up adoption pattern means your pricing must support discovery and experimentation, not gate it.
The developer community amplifies pricing decisions. A frustrating paywall experience gets shared in engineering channels, on Hacker News, and in tool comparison threads. Conversely, generous free tiers and transparent technical feature gating build advocacy that no marketing budget can replicate.
Developers also approach pricing with healthy skepticism. They've been burned by tools that promised unlimited usage, then introduced restrictive tiers. They've watched essential features migrate behind paywalls after acquisition. Your developer tool tiers must demonstrate long-term predictability while still capturing value as teams scale.
Effective technical feature gating operates across three distinct dimensions: usage, capabilities, and support. Structuring your pricing around these layers creates natural upgrade triggers without artificially limiting core functionality.
Usage layer: Consumption-based metrics that scale with team size and project scope—active repositories, scan frequency, lines of code analyzed, or active committers.
Capability layer: Feature sophistication that unlocks additional value—custom rule creation, advanced security analysis, compliance frameworks, or enterprise integrations.
Support layer: Access and assurance levels—response time SLAs, dedicated success managers, training, and implementation assistance.
Choose consumption metrics that feel fair and predictable. The best usage gates scale naturally with the value teams extract from your tool.
Effective metrics for code quality tools:
Example tier structure:
Avoid metrics that feel punitive or difficult to predict—charging per vulnerability found, for instance, creates perverse incentives and budget anxiety.
The cardinal rule: never gate basic code quality detection. Your core analysis engine must demonstrate value before you ask developers to pay. Gate sophistication, not functionality.
What to keep accessible (Free/Starter tiers):
What to gate at mid-tiers (Team/Pro):
What to reserve for Enterprise:
Successful developer tool pricing follows recognizable patterns worth studying.
GitHub maintains generous free tiers for public repositories while monetizing team collaboration features, security scanning, and enterprise governance. Their pricing respects the open-source ecosystem that drives adoption.
Snyk offers a free tier for individual developers (up to 200 open-source tests/month) that expands into team and enterprise tiers based on test volume, integrations, and security features. Their transparency about usage limits builds trust.
SonarQube operates a community edition (free, self-hosted) alongside commercial editions that add security analysis, branch analysis, and portfolio management. This open-core model captures enterprise value while maintaining community goodwill.
The pattern: give individual developers enough capability to evaluate and advocate internally, then capture value when teams operationalize and enterprises require governance.
Beyond usage gating, how you bundle technical capabilities signals your understanding of developer workflows.
Integration depth creates natural tiers:
Language and framework support:
Consider tiering advanced or niche language support. Core languages (JavaScript, Python, Java) should be universally available; specialized frameworks or legacy language support can differentiate higher tiers.
Integration gating requires careful calibration. Gate too aggressively, and you block the workflows that drive adoption. Gate too loosely, and you leave enterprise value uncaptured.
Keep open: GitHub, GitLab, Bitbucket basics; popular IDE extensions; common CI tools (Jenkins, CircleCI, GitHub Actions)
Gate at higher tiers: Enterprise systems (Jira Server, ServiceNow), custom webhook configurations, advanced notification routing
Reserve for Enterprise: SSO/SAML authentication, SCIM provisioning, on-premises connectors, air-gapped deployment support
Gating basic functionality: If developers can't experience meaningful value within your free tier, they'll never advocate for paid adoption. Evaluate whether your free tier would impress a senior engineer during a 20-minute evaluation.
Unclear unit economics: Developers budget for tools. If they can't predict costs as their team or codebase grows, they'll choose competitors with transparent pricing. Publish calculators and usage estimators.
Surprise overages: Nothing destroys trust faster than unexpected bills. Implement soft caps with warnings, grace periods, and clear communication before hard enforcement.
Hidden pricing pages: Developers expect self-serve transparency. "Contact sales for pricing" on anything except true enterprise deals signals you're not optimizing for developer experience.
Traditional SaaS metrics don't capture the full picture for developer tools. Track these alongside revenue:
Activation rate: What percentage of signups successfully complete a meaningful workflow (first scan, first issue resolved)?
Time to value: How quickly do new users experience your core benefit? Shorter times correlate with stronger conversion.
Expansion velocity: How quickly do individual users become team accounts? Team accounts become enterprise deals?
Community sentiment: Monitor developer forums, social mentions, and tool comparison threads. Negative pricing sentiment spreads faster than positive experiences.
Competitive win rates: Track why you win and lose deals. Pricing-related losses indicate tier structure problems; feature-related losses suggest packaging issues.
Moving from current pricing to new developer tool tiers requires careful execution:
Download our Developer Tool Pricing Calculator — model different tier structures and usage metrics to find your optimal pricing strategy.

Join companies like Zoom, DocuSign, and Twilio using our systematic pricing approach to increase revenue by 12-40% year-over-year.